Jobs Summary Report
The Jobs Summary report — what it shows, what columns export, and how to filter.
Where to find it
Reports → Jobs Summary. Menu label in the Reports nav: Jobs Summary.
What it shows
The report visualizes per-job candidate flow:
- Candidate status breakdown per job — Received, Shortlisted, Interviewed, Joined.
- Days taken per status for each job — rendered as a horizontal stacked bar chart.
- Job title × time visualization for at-a-glance comparison across roles.
Filtering
Available filters on this report:
- Date range.
- Job selector.
- Customer (for staffing-agency workspaces).
- Department.
Pick the slice you care about; the chart redraws on filter change.
Exporting
The export button reads Export to CSV with a dropdown for image formats:
- Export to JPEG
- Export to PNG
- Export to SVG
CSV columns
The CSV includes:
- Job Title
- Job Code
- Department
- Customer
- Job Created Date
- Highest Candidate Status
- Job Closed Date
Practical reads
- Highest Candidate Status per job tells you how far the most-progressed candidate has reached. Useful for spotting jobs where nothing has cleared the screen.
- Days at each status shows where time is being spent. Long Shared-to-Shortlisted gaps usually mean the recruiter is overwhelmed.
- Compare two similar jobs side by side using the Job filter — outliers tell you which is healthy.
Tips
- Run weekly with a 30-day rolling window to spot stalls.
- Export the CSV before quarterly reviews — slicing in a spreadsheet is faster than fiddling with the in-app filters for ad-hoc analysis.
- Use Department filter for QBR conversations with each function head.
